Skip to content
English
  • There are no suggestions because the search field is empty.

How to | Import and Associate Trade Show Registrations

Master your event data by importing attendee lists and linking them to hapily event records for better cross-referencing and ROI reporting.

This guide outlines how to use a custom contact property and a HubSpot workflow to automatically link a list of imported contacts (such as trade show or conference attendees) to a specific hapily event record.

By following this process, you can:

  • Import a CSV of known attendees directly into HubSpot.

  • Automatically create associations between contacts and your event record.

  • Differentiate between "Known Registrants" and "Actual Attendees" for better ROI reporting.

  • Maintain a clean cross-reference of everyone who was expected at the event.

🎥 Video Walkthrough: 

How to | Import Event Registration Lists as Known Attendees - Watch Video


Step 1: Create the Custom Contact Property

Before importing your list, you need a place to store the unique ID of the event.

  1. In HubSpot, navigate to Settings > Objects > Properties.

  2. Select Contact as the object type.

  3. Click Create property.

  4. Set the Label to Known Attendee Event Record ID (or a similar clear name).

  5. Set the Field Type to Single-line text.

  6. Click Create.

Screenshot on 2026-04-02 at 10-54-58.png


Step 2: Create the Association Label

To distinguish these imported contacts from other associated records, create a specific label.

  1. Navigate to your hapily event settings.

  2. Create a new Association Label between the Contact object and the hapily Event object.

  3. Set the Label name to Known Attendee.

Screenshot on 2026-04-02 at 10-55-21.png


Step 3: Build the Automation Workflow

This workflow will handle the heavy lifting of linking the contact to the correct event record.

  1. Create a new Contact-based workflow.

  2. Name it: Event Attendee Import - Associate to Event.

  3. Set the Enrollment Trigger to: Known Attendee Event Record ID is known.

  4. Enable Re-enrollment for this trigger so you can reuse this process for future events.

  5. Add the action: Apply association labels.

  6. Configure the labels to be applied between the Contact and the hapily Event.

  7. Select the Known Attendee label created in Step 2.

  8. Choose to apply this when the Known Attendee Event Record ID on the contact matches the Record ID of the event.

  9. Review and Turn on the workflow.


Step 4: Import Your Contact List

Now you are ready to bring your data into HubSpot.

  1. Open your spreadsheet of trade show attendees.

  2. Add a column for Known Attendee Event Record ID.

  3. Copy the Record ID from the specific hapily event record in HubSpot and paste it into this column for every contact in your sheet.

  4. Import the CSV into HubSpot, ensuring you map your new column to the Known Attendee Event Record ID property.

  5. The workflow will trigger, and the contacts will appear on your event record with the correct label.
    Screenshot on 2026-04-02 at 10-54-30.png


Summary

✅ Created a custom contact property to hold the Event ID. ✅ Established a specific association label for tracking. ✅ Built an automated workflow to link contacts to events based on ID matching. ✅ Streamlined the import process for trade show and conference data.